OMG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

145 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in OM GROUP INC. (OMG)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$1.15B — up 6.1% from $1.09B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 19 funds closed out of OMG and 9 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 60 trimmed existing stakes and 51 added.

The largest buyer was Lord, Abbett & Co, adding an estimated $18.4M. The largest seller was Snow Capital Management, cutting an estimated $34.5M.
